Rickie Lee Jones was born in Chicago on 8 November, 1954. She settled in LA at the age of nineteen, doing the classic waiting tables stuff until she landed a recording contract with Warners. Her first album in 1979 was a big success, as was the single "Chuck E's in Love" about her musician friend Chuck E. Weiss. She won a Grammy for Best New Artist.
